Central heating and air systems circulate conditioned air across two critical bottleneck components: the blower wheel squirrel cage and the indoor evaporator coil. In Santa Clara County homes, ambient outdoor particulate from seasonal dry spells, agricultural dust from the Central Valley, and summer wildfire smoke infiltrate return ducts. Over 3 to 5 years, this microscopic debris bypasses standard 1-inch MERV 8 filters. When fine dust contacts the damp surface of an active cooling coil, it forms a dense, clay-like crust between the 14-to-18 aluminum fins per inch. Simultaneously, centrifugal blower wheel blades accumulate a concave layer of grime on their curved surfaces. A mere 1/16th-inch accumulation of bonded dust on blower blades reduces airflow volume by up to 20%, forcing the compressor and furnace heat exchanger to run longer cycles while circulating musty odors and worsening nighttime allergy symptoms in bedrooms.

Selecting standalone coil and blower maintenance fits specific diagnostic conditions. If registers discharge weak air volume despite fresh pleated filters, or if family members notice metallic or stale aromas when the air conditioning initiates, the restriction resides inside the air handler rather than the supply duct runs. The mechanical trade-off centers on service scope: cleaning duct branch lines removes loose debris resting inside sheet metal or flex runs, but duct cleaning alone cannot restore static pressure if the evaporator coil fins remain choked with biological slime. Conversely, restoring the coil and blower wheel optimizes system airflow, heat transfer, and humidity extraction, yet uncleaned supply trunks can recontaminate a freshly washed coil over subsequent months if significant duct debris remains unaddressed.

Step 1: Diagnostic inspection begins by shutting down electrical breakers, removing access panels, and inserting digital borescope cameras to document fin blockages and measure external static pressure across the cooling coil.

Step 2: Technicians extract the squirrel cage blower assembly, disconnect motor wiring harnesses, and mechanically dislodge compacted grease and dust from every individual curved blade utilizing targeted agitation and HEPA-filtered vacuum extraction.

Step 3: The indoor evaporator coil receives an application of EPA-registered, alkaline-balanced foaming cleaner that expands through the coil depth, pushing suspended particulates into the primary drain pan.

Step 4: Technicians clear the primary and secondary condensate drain lines using pressurized nitrogen to eliminate standing microbial sludge and prevent water pan overflow.

Step 5: The blower assembly is reinstalled, motor amperage is verified against manufacturer nameplate specifications, and complete before-and-after digital imagery is delivered to the homeowner.

How often should an evaporator coil and blower wheel be cleaned in San Jose homes?
San Jose homes benefit from evaporator coil and blower wheel cleanings every 3 to 5 years, though residences near foothills prone to brush fire fallout or properties undergoing interior remodeling require inspection every 2 years.
What causes musty air handler odors in San Jose residential HVAC systems?
Musty HVAC odors in San Jose stem from condensation moisture mixing with organic house dust on evaporator coil surfaces, fostering microbial colonies that multiply inside drain pans when relative indoor humidity fluctuates.
Can dirty blower components increase household electrical bills in Santa Clara County?
Restricted blower wheels and matted evaporator coils elevate household utility expenses because reduced cubic feet per minute (CFM) forces cooling cycles to run 15% to 30% longer to satisfy thermostat settings.
Does cleaning an evaporator coil require cutting open indoor drywall in two-story homes?
Cleaning an evaporator coil does not require drywall damage in two-story San Jose homes, as technicians access coils directly through existing manufacturer plenum panels and cabinet access doors.
